Pronunciation(Pinyin): Dài
Strokes: 6
Meaning: To wear; to put on; to adorn
Pronunciation(Pinyin): fāng
Strokes: 4
Meaning: Square; direction; aspect; a type of herb
Pronunciation(Pinyin): lán
Strokes: 12
Meaning: Wave; large body of water; a vast expanse of water
A name that suggests a person with a square and steady character, accompanied by a spirit of adventure and vastness of mind.
The surname '戴' is associated with the Han Dynasty noble family, while the given name '方澜' combines elements of stability and a dynamic, expansive nature.
